Gents,

33 year old newby who is jumping into his first resto project on a Elsinore 125 with the old man. Coupole of questions:

1. can anyoone tell me where I can check Honda VIN numbers (frame and engine) to see what year it is?
2. Anyone know what the bike "looked" like? I am looking to find paint for the engine, pipe, and frame for a 73/74 Elsinbone 125. I think they were all different (frame=gloss, engine=semi-gloss, pipe=flat) but am unsure.

Any help is appreciated!

I always go here for identifying Honda models.
http://100megsfree4.com/honda/

Pretty sure the first couple of years all CRs had black powder coated frames. The CR125 went to red frame one year after the CR250 ~1978 or so.
